Find the value of x.<br><br> (x + 4)<br> 147°
larisa86 [58]

Answer:

<h2>x = 29°</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

From the question the angles lie on a straight line which means that the sum of their angles add up to 180°

Since angles on a straight line add up to 180°

To find the value of x add up all the angles and equate it to 180 to find x

That's

x + 4 + 147 = 180

x + 151 = 180

x = 180 - 151

We have the final answer as

<h3>x = 29°</h3>
